Salary Band C: £20,281 - £23,919pa dependent on experience (pro rata) plus pension contribution. Initial fixed term contract to 31 December 2010 with possible extension subject to funding We require a part-time (14:48 hours per week) Midlands Fritillaries Project Officer to contribute to an exciting new project to help to conserve fritillary butterflies in eight important areas of the Midlands. In addition to the focus on High Brown Fritillary, Pearl-bordered Fritillary and Small Pearl-bordered Fritillary, the work will benefit a number of other rare and threatened species. Principal duties are recruiting, training and supporting volunteers and coordinating a fritillary survey and monitoring programme. Other duties include liaison with partner organisations, helping to organise a programme of habitat management and providing management advice to landowners. Experience of working with volunteers, good communication skills and knowledge of nature conservation are essential. |
